首页 > 解决方案 > iOS 推送通知以删除已发送的通知

问题描述

我正在开发一个使用 react-native 和 FCM Push Notification (rnfirebase 5.6.x) 的应用程序项目。当用户收到一些消息时我会发送一个通知,如果用户在另一个来源(如我们的网络应用程序)上阅读该消息,我需要删除该传递的通知。

在应用程序打开或在后台运行时,我可以发送另一个带有一些 userInfo 的推送,让我知道我需要删除什么。

一切都很完美......除非用户杀死应用程序。然后我无法控制收到的通知......

我尝试在通知数据上使用 tag 属性,但根据 firebase,它仅适用于 Android。

关于如何做到这一点的任何想法?

标签: iosreact-nativepush-notificationreact-native-iosreact-native-firebase

解决方案


推荐阅读